If you're considering leveling your gravel driveway in Renton, WA, it's essential to understand the costs involved. The expense can vary based on several factors, including the size of your driveway, the extent of leveling required, and the materials used. This guide will help you estimate the cost and understand what influences it.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Driveway Size: Larger driveways require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Extent of Leveling Needed: Minor adjustments are less costly than significant leveling, which may require more extensive work.
- Material Quality: Higher-quality gravel and additional materials can increase the price but offer better durability.
- Labor Costs: Rates can vary depending on the expertise and availability of local contractors.
- Equipment Usage: Specialized equipment can speed up the process but may add to the cost.
- Permits and Regulations: Local permits and compliance with regulations can also influence the final expense.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task Description | Average Cost (Renton, WA) |
---|---|
Minor leveling and filling | $500 - $1,000 |
Major leveling and resurfacing | $1,500 - $3,000 |
High-quality gravel material | $50 - $75 per ton |
Labor (per hour) | $50 - $100 |
Equipment rental (per day) | $200 - $400 |
Permit fees | $50 - $150 |
